About Jevan Cevik

Jevan Cevik is a scholar working on Surgery, Health Informatics,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Oncology and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, having authored 35 papers that have together received 237 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Reconstructive Surgery and Microvascular Techniques (8 papers), Artificial Intelligence in Healthcare and Education (6 papers), Vascular Procedures and Complications (3 papers), Body Contouring and Surgery (3 papers),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(3 papers), Reconstructive Facial Surgery Techniques (2 papers), Cutaneous Melanoma Detection and Management (2 papers) and Anatomy and Medical Technology (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Health Informatics (112 citations), Rehabilitation (21 citations), Family Practice (6 citations), Health Information Management (9 citations) and Surgery (80 citations). Jevan Cevik has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, Italy and Mexico. Frequent co-authors include Warren M. Rozen, Ishith Seth, Bryan Lim, Richard J. Ross, Roberto Cuomo, Yi Xie, David J. Hunter‐Smith, Anand Ramakrishnan, Miguel S. Cabalag and Rory G Middleton.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Medicine, ANZ Journal of Surgery, Journal of Personalized Medicine, Travel Medicine and Infectious Disease and Journal of Hand Surgery (European Volume).
